zoukankan      html  css  js  c++  java
  • 0422 数学口袋精灵app

    首先要部署这个app项目就是第一步:

    一.前提下载并安装JDK

    在线图解:手把手教你安装JDK      http://www.lvtao.net/server/windows-setup-jdk.html

    二.下载并安装eclipse

    http://jingyan.baidu.com/article/d7130635194f1513fcf47557.html

    安装eclipse安装完成后就是搭建一个Android的运行环境。下载adt插件并安装:

    ADT插件的下载路径:

    进行离线安装ADT包,以下是步骤,跟着一步步来就行了,如果你不行就别找我,问度娘吧!!!

    选择Work with:后的Add...→在Local选项中输入Android Plugin→在Archive中找到ADT的压缩包→点击OK→在下面勾选Name中的选项即可。

    成功!!!!!!!!!

    三.fork师姐的数学口袋精灵app项目并导入eclipse中

    从Eclipse中选择File-》import-》Git-》来自GIT项目

    选择next-》选择URI

    选择next,粘贴如下信息(注意填上您在github上申请的账号密码):

    四.进行单元测试

    package name.feisky.android.test;
    import android.test.AndroidTestCase;
    import junit.framework.Assert;

    public class PersonServiceTest extends AndroidTestCase{
    public void testSave()throws Exception{
    PersonService service=new PersonService();
    service.save(null);
    }

    public void testAdd()throws Exception{
    PersonService service=new PersonService();
    int result=service.add(1, 2);
    Assert.assertEquals(3, result);
    }

    public void testAdd1()throws Exception{
    PersonService service=new PersonService();
    int result=service.add1(1, 2);
    Assert.assertEquals(0.5, result);
    }

    public void testAdd2()throws Exception{
    PersonService service=new PersonService();
    int result=service.add2(1, 2);
    Assert.assertEquals(3, result);
    }

    public void testAdd3()throws Exception{
    PersonService service=new PersonService();
    int result=service.add3(1, 2);
    Assert.assertEquals(0.5, result);
    }
    }

    五、使用APP

    我们使用手机下载了“数学口袋精灵”来体验一下,一开始觉得不错的,但是玩着玩着突然发现了一些bug,具体如下:

    1.完成题目输出方框里显示不全

    2.APP屏幕没有的占用手机全部屏幕

    3.当答完全部题目后无法退出答题界面

    4.发现某些手机安装后无法打开,出现闪退(例如我的手机)                   

    5.部分题目难度过大,连我自己都不会算                   

    6.无难度选择,都不适合各人群使用

    7.pass和fail放在猴子身上,会引起误解

    8、在运行过程中会有时出现程序闪退。

    9、运行过程中音乐没办法关闭。

    列志华 http://www.cnblogs.com/liezhihua/ 组长,团队 
    黄柏堂  http://www.cnblogs.com/huang123/   
    韩麒麟  http://www.cnblogs.com/hanqilin/   
    王俊杰  http://www.cnblogs.com/wangjunjie123/ 

    总结:

    每个人都很努力,但是要学习一门完全不了解的语言也不是说能做好就能做好的,还是要先借鉴他人的学习,还要努力,但是离写Android APP还有距离,总感觉时间不够用。因为要做这个要先Android入门,但是我们都没有学过Android,所以就两天时间凑合出来的东西,你们就别想有多么的高大上了吧,不嫌弃的就看看吧,嫌弃的尽管喷,无~所~谓。

    列志华:27%
    王俊杰:26%
    韩麒麟:24%
    黄柏堂:23%
  • 相关阅读:
    SharePoint与RMS集成中关于权限的一个技术点
    SharePoint Alert
    SharePoint Explorer View
    在查看network traffic的时候, TCP Chimney offload的影响
    SharePoint Profile Import
    为SharePoint添加Event Receiver
    通过Telnet来发送邮件
    如何查看扩展出来的web application?
    Windows Host 文件
    Wscript.Shell 对象详细介绍
  • 原文地址:https://www.cnblogs.com/liezhihua/p/5423005.html
Copyright © 2011-2022 走看看